Eastleigh Business Community Hosts Lunch for Ex-Somali Prime Minister

Eastleigh Business Community in Nairobi hosted lunch for a former Prime Minister of Somalia.

Members of the business community invited ex-Prime Minister Mohamed Hussein Roble for lunch on Friday, September 23.

The lunch took place in Nairobi, the capital city of Kenya.

During the lunch, ex-Prime Minister Roble and members of the business community discussed several issues.

Discussions touching on the welfare of the Somali community in Kenya dominated their talks.

Furthermore, they also shared views on the measures to take to improve trade relations between Somalia and Kenya.
